diff --git a/Docs/architecture/recipe-grid-surface.md b/Docs/architecture/recipe-grid-surface.md index bf8f34f..2ceb3d3 100644 --- a/Docs/architecture/recipe-grid-surface.md +++ b/Docs/architecture/recipe-grid-surface.md @@ -171,6 +171,18 @@ and every dead member would have to be implemented and contract-tested by each f subscribes and sets its native selection (`null` clears). `RequestSelection` is a safe no-op after `Dispose()`. +**Index-shift reconciliation.** An index-shifting mutation (an insert or remove at/before a +selected step) moves the steps the cached `SelectedStepIndices` point at. The cache is +reconciled arithmetically inside `RecipeGridSurfaceBase.OnMutation` via `ShiftSelection`, +driven by the `MutationSignal`, not by any control-level selection event: `StepsInserted` shifts +each index at/after the insert up by the count, `StepRemoved`/`StepsRemoved` drop the removed +indices and shift survivors down, and `RecipeReplaced` clears the cache. This keeps the +invariant on both surfaces without an `ISelectionModel`, which matters because the canonical +`DataGrid` fires no selection push on an insert-before or a remove-of-selected. `ShiftSelection` +is a pure function of `(previous indices, signal)`; the snapshot is taken at the top of +`OnMutation` and assigned after the item mutation, guarded by sequence-equality so a mid-mutation +control push (the transposed `ListBox` on remove-selected) is not double-applied. + ## Orientation switching `ActiveRecipeGridSurface` is the single owner of orientation. One existing test asserts the OLD buggy behavior and MUST be updated (see Task 2). +- **no perf claim**: correctness fix; no baseline/gate. + +## Acceptance Evidence +Reproduction is automatable; the evidence is a runnable test, not a description. + +- **Baseline, measured 2026-07-22** (throwaway headless probe against current master, since deleted): + - Canonical (DataGrid), select row 2 then `InsertStep(0)`: cache `[2]` → `[2]` (STALE); the DataGrid shifted its own `SelectedIndex` 2→3 keeping the same item, and fired NO `SelectionChanged` push. + - Canonical (DataGrid), multi-select rows `{0,2,4}` then `RemoveStep(2)`: cache `[0,2,4]` → `[0,2,4]` (STALE); the DataGrid dropped to 2 selected rows and fired NO push. + - Transposed (ListBox), select row 2 then `RemoveStep(2)`: control fires `SelectionChanged`, cache reconciles correctly (`TransposedSelectionIndexTests.cs:92` pins this — NOT stale). + - Transposed (ListBox), select row 2 then `InsertStep(0)`: cache stays `[2]` STALE — `TransposedSelectionIndexTests.cs:130` currently pins this staleness as the known follow-up. + - Undo/Redo (`RecipeReplaced` → full rebuild): BOTH controls clear the cache to `[]` (selection dropped, not stale). +- **Pass condition after the fix** — run: + `dotnet test SemiStep/SemiStep.Tests/SemiStep.Tests.csproj --filter "FullyQualifiedName~SelectionShift"` + - Insert-before-selection shifts the cache up by the insert count, on BOTH grids. + - Remove-before-selection shifts survivors down and drops removed indices, on BOTH grids. + - Insert/remove AFTER the selection leaves the cache unchanged, on BOTH grids. + - Consumer end-to-end: select → insert-before → `RemoveSteps(SelectedStepIndices)` deletes the originally-selected step (now at its shifted index), on BOTH grids. + - `RecipeReplaced` clears the cache to `[]`. + +## Progress Tracking +- mark completed items `[x]` immediately. +- add newly discovered tasks with ➕ prefix; blockers with ⚠️ prefix. +- keep this plan in sync with actual work. + +## Solution Overview +Maintain `SelectedStepIndices` as a pure function of `(previous indices, mutation signal)`, applied in the shared surface at mutation time. This is the same transaction that drove the `Items` mutation applied to the selection projection — not a hand-maintained duplicate of a control's state. + +Why here and not via a control signal (the rejected alternative): +- The canonical grid is an Avalonia `DataGrid` whose selection is `RecipeGrid.SelectedItems`, with no `ISelectionModel` and no `IndexesChanged`. The 2026-07-22 probe confirmed it fires no push on either insert-before or remove-selected, so there is no signal to subscribe. A control-signal fix would work on the ListBox and silently fail on the DataGrid. +- Both surfaces subscribe `coordinator.Mutated` in the base constructor (`RecipeGridSurfaceBase.cs:80`), so `OnMutation` runs even for the orientation-flipped-away grid whose view is detached. A view-side fix cannot cover that surface; a surface-side fix does. +- `OnMutation` sees every signal including `RecipeReplaced`, so the cache-clear-on-rebuild lives in the same place. + +Reentrancy (the one sharp edge): inside `OnMutation`, `Items.Insert/RemoveAt` raises `CollectionChanged` synchronously and the transposed ListBox reacts before the code after the `switch` runs. On a remove that includes a selected index the ListBox fires `SelectionChanged` mid-`switch` and pushes the correct post-shift indices. To avoid double-shifting, snapshot the cache at the TOP of `OnMutation`, compute the shift from the snapshot, and assign AFTER the `switch`. For the transposed remove-selected case the snapshot-computed value equals the control's pushed value, so a sequence-equality guard makes the assignment a no-op; for every other case (all DataGrid cases, ListBox insert-before) the surface is the sole writer. Verified by the 2026-07-22 probe: the only control that pushes mid-mutation is the ListBox on remove-selected, and it agrees. + +## Technical Details +Add a pure static shift function and call it from `OnMutation`; retire `ReconcileSelectionWithItems`. + +The shift applies to the four index-affecting signals ONLY. Every other signal leaves the cache untouched — assigning for them is what would fight the control (see `StepActionChanged` below). + +`ShiftSelection(IReadOnlyList selection, MutationSignal signal) -> IReadOnlyList`, defined for: +- `StepsInserted(startIndex, count)`: each `i` → `i >= startIndex ? i + count : i`. +- `StepRemoved(removedIndex)`: drop `i == removedIndex`; each survivor → `i > removedIndex ? i - 1 : i`. +- `StepsRemoved(removedIndices)`: drop any `i` in `removedIndices`; each survivor → `i - (number of removed indices < i)`. +- `RecipeReplaced`: return `[]` (full rebuild invalidates every index). + +Signals the shift does NOT assign for (cache left as-is): +- `StepAppended` — adds at the tail, past every selected index; no index moves. +- `PropertyUpdated` — no structural change. +- `StepActionChanged` — `RebuildItem` (`:461`) does `Items[stepIndex] = item`, replacing the reference at a stable index. The cached index stays valid, so the shift leaves it alone. In the live UI the control drops the replaced item and `OnActionChanged` (`:324`) calls `RequestSelection(result.Value)` (`:346`), which re-selects and repushes the cache. Assigning here would re-assert the pre-mutation snapshot and fight that push — hence no assignment for this signal. +- `StateRefreshed` — `OnMutation` already `return`s early at `:181` before reaching the shift. + +`OnMutation` shape: +- At the top, before the `switch`: `var selectionSnapshot = SelectedStepIndices;` +- Keep the existing `switch` that mutates `Items` unchanged, preserving both early-outs that bypass the shift: the `StateRefreshed` `return` (`:181`) and the `UnknownActionKeyException` catch-`return` (`:191`). +- Replace the `ReconcileSelectionWithItems()` call (`:194`) with: for `StepsInserted`/`StepRemoved`/`StepsRemoved`/`RecipeReplaced` only, compute `var shifted = ShiftSelection(selectionSnapshot, signal);` and assign `SelectedStepIndices = shifted` when `shifted` is not sequence-equal to the current `SelectedStepIndices` (a mid-`switch` control push may already have set the same value — the guard avoids churn and, for the transposed remove-selected case, a redundant re-assign). For all other signals, do nothing. +- Delete `ReconcileSelectionWithItems` (`:216`): a correct shift drops out-of-range indices on removal and clears on rebuild, so the drop-only clamp is subsumed. Leaving it would be a second, disagreeing writer. + +Invariant after the change: for the four index-affecting signals, `SelectedStepIndices` is consistent with `Items` and equal to what the live control selection would report — independent of whether a control is attached. Non-index signals leave the cache untouched; where selection needs to move for them (`StepActionChanged`), the existing `RequestSelection` path governs it. + +## What Goes Where +- **Implementation Steps** (`[ ]`): the shift function, the `OnMutation` change, test coverage, doc note. +- **Post-Completion** (no checkboxes): manual smoke on the live app; unrelated follow-ups tracked separately. + +## Implementation Steps + +### Task 1: Red surface-level tests reproducing the stale cache on both grids + +**Files:** +- Create: `SemiStep/SemiStep.Tests/UI/RecipeGrid/Transposed/TransposedSelectionShiftTests.cs` +- Create: `SemiStep/SemiStep.Tests/UI/RecipeGrid/CanonicalSelectionShiftTests.cs` + +- [x] Transposed: seed a recipe, select index 2, `Coordinator.InsertStep(0, ...)`, `RunJobs`, assert `surface.SelectedStepIndices` == `[3]` (currently FAILS — proves the bug). +- [x] Canonical: same scenario via the DataGrid harness, assert cache == `[3]` (currently FAILS). +- [x] Canonical: multi-select `{0,2,4}`, `Coordinator.RemoveStep(2)`, assert cache == `[0,3]` (currently FAILS — DataGrid fires no push). +- [x] Run — the new tests FAIL for the right reason (stale indices); the rest of the suite stays green. + +### Task 2: Shift the cache in `OnMutation`; retire the clamp + +**Files:** +- Modify: `SemiStep/SemiStep.UI/RecipeGrid/RecipeGridSurfaceBase.cs` +- Modify: `SemiStep/SemiStep.Tests/UI/RecipeGrid/Transposed/TransposedSelectionIndexTests.cs` + +- [x] Add the pure `ShiftSelection(selection, signal)` per Technical Details — defined for `StepsInserted`/`StepRemoved`/`StepsRemoved` (shift) and `RecipeReplaced` (clear). +- [x] Snapshot `SelectedStepIndices` at the top of `OnMutation`; after the `switch`, for those four signals ONLY assign `ShiftSelection(snapshot, signal)` guarded by sequence-equality; assign nothing for other signals; preserve the `StateRefreshed` (`:181`) and exception-catch (`:191`) early returns; remove the `ReconcileSelectionWithItems()` call and delete the method. +- [x] Update `TransposedSelectionIndexTests.cs:130` (`InsertStepBeforeSelection_...LeavesSurfaceIndicesUntouched`) — it pins the OLD stale behavior; rename/retarget it to assert the shifted indices and the control/cache agreement.
